While I am definitely a Shabby Chic kind of gal, I know not everyone is. So if you fall into the Modern camp, PRIME and [hate this] have a couple of offerings that will suit your style in this month’s Heaven theme for The Challenge.

The Neon Angel wings, from [hate this] come in separate left and right pieces (in case you are a one-winged angel) and have options for colour, glow and lighting. Use them to flank your artwork or just display them on their own. Heck, get creative and use them as photo props for your own heavenly version of a Rhinestone Cowboy! The possibilities are only limited by your imagination.

The artwork is an original creation by Reven Rosca. Do try it in different lighting; it really does make the various parts of the picture stand out. And it goes well with a new living room set that has been recently released by PRIME. The perfect accompaniment to a modern design.
